Art & Character of Nutcrackers by Arlene Wagner
The Art & Character of Nutcrackers
Beyond visions of sugarplum fairies and
wooden men with white beards, the
nutcrackers featured in The Art &
Character of Nutcrackers are
elegant, sophisticated, rustic pieces of
usable art steeped in history and tradition.
Beautifully photographed, rare, and
valuable, these nutcrackers from around the
world are collected and celebrated in one
book for the first time ever.
What began as and innocent purchase during
a production of the Nutcracker Ballet has
blossomed into a world-renowned collection
almost 40 years in the making. The author,
Arlene Wagner has amassed more than 5,000
pieces housed in the Leavenworth Nutcracker
Museum, on display to the public.

The Nutcracker ETA Hoffmann / Maurice Sendak
The tale of Nutcracker, written by E.T.A.
Hoffmann in 1816, has fascinated and inspired
artists, composers, and audiences for almost
two hundred years. It has retained its
freshness because it appeals to the sense of
wonder we all share.
Maurice Sendak designed brilliant sets and
costumes for the Pacific Northwest Ballets
Christmas production of Nutcracker and
created even more magnificent pictures
especially for this book. He joined with the
eminent translator Ralph Manheim to produce
this illustrated edition of Hoffmanns
wonderful tale, destined to become a classic
for all ages. Illustrations in Detail
The world of Nutcracker is a world of
pleasures. Maurice Sendaks art illuminates
the delights of Hoffmanns story in this rich
and tantalizing treasure.

Nativities of the World by Susan Topp Weber
This book includes photographs of over ninety-six nativities
from all over the world. Each nativities is shown in full
color, with supporting text by Susan Topp Weber. The appendix
lists where collections of nativities can be seen in the
United States and Europe.
The nativities that appear in Weber's book have never been
published. Their materials range from wheat straw
(Bangladesh) to wrought iron (Ecuador) to churro wool
(Navajo) to felt (Kazakhstan) to stone (Peru). An Australian
version features native animals, such as kangaroos.
A Slovakian artist created a nativity from corn husks. A
Czech fiber artist wove the Holy Family from bobbin lace. An
Irish knitter stitched the stable scene in wool. An Hawaiian
artist made the shelter from a coconut; the star above it is
a tiny starfish.
Susan began collecting in 1965 and has sold nativities since
1978 in her Santa Fe shop, Susan's Christmas Shop.
